Mar 4, 2026EISUTEAS STATEMENT OF USE RECEIVEDThe applicant filed a Statement of Use with specimens showing the mark in actual commerce. The USPTO will review the filing for compliance. If accepted, the mark can proceed to registration; if deficient, the USPTO may issue a requirement or office action.
Sep 9, 2025NOAMNOA E-MAILED - SOU REQUIRED FROM APPLICANTA Notice of Allowance means your intent-to-use application cleared examination and opposition but is not registered yet. You must file a Statement of Use showing the mark in commerce, or request an extension, before the deadline — usually six months from the notice date.
Jul 15, 2025NPUBOFFICIAL GAZETTE PUBLICATION CONFIRMATION E-MAILED
Jul 15, 2025PUBOPUBLISHED FOR OPPOSITIONYour mark was published in the USPTO Official Gazette for a 30-day opposition window. During that period, third parties who believe they would be harmed can file an opposition. If no opposition is filed, prosecution usually continues toward registration or a Notice of Allowance.
